About Lampeter/Llanbedr Pont Stefan
Lampeter, located in Ceredigion, Wales, is a small town known for its university and a variety of local shops and cafes. The town centre features a mix of traditional and modern architecture, providing a pleasant atmosphere for visitors. The annual Lampeter Food Festival, held in the summer, showcases local produce and attracts many attendees, highlighting the community's commitment to supporting local businesses.
Llanbedr Pont Steffan, often referred to as Lampeter, is situated near the River Teifi, which offers opportunities for leisurely walks along its banks. The town is also close to several historical sites, including the nearby St. Peter's Church, which dates back to the 12th century. With its convenient location, Lampeter serves as a gateway to exploring the surrounding countryside and the scenic landscapes of Ceredigion.

Household Income in Lampeter/Llanbedr Pont Stefan ONS 2023
The average total household income in Lampeter/Llanbedr Pont Stefan is approximately £40,924 a year before tax, 26% below the national average of £55,302. After tax and benefits, the average disposable (net) household income is around £31,621. These are modelled estimates from the Office for National Statistics for the financial year ending 2023.

Businesses in Lampeter/Llanbedr Pont Stefan ONS 2025
There are approximately 639 active businesses based in Lampeter/Llanbedr Pont Stefan, around 68 for every 1,000 residents. The local economy is dominated by small firms: about 94% are micro-businesses employing fewer than 10 people, while 4 are larger employers with 50 or more staff. Figures are from the Office for National Statistics UK Business Counts.

Home Ownership in Lampeter/Llanbedr Pont Stefan
Of the 4,102 households in and around Lampeter/Llanbedr Pont Stefan, 72% are owned, 9% are socially rented and 19% are privately rented. Home ownership here is higher than the England and Wales average of 63%.
Tenure from the 2021 Census (ONS), for the postcode districts covering Lampeter/Llanbedr Pont Stefan.
